Melinda Clark is a psychologist with a warm and professional approach, based at Concord Repatriation General Hospital in the Psychology Department. Degree and years of experience aren’t specified here, but she brings a respectful, patient-friendly style to her care. Her workplace is the Concord West clinic area at Building 43, Hospital Road, Concord West NSW 2138, serving the local NSW community with accessible mental health support.
Melinda offers a range of evidence-based services to help people manage stress, feel better, and cope with daily life. She provides counseling sessions and therapy sessions, including behavioral therapy and c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T). She also teaches practical stress management techniques that people can use in the moment and over time.
